Will the mixed-use projects dominate the market
Offices, conference area, hotel, services, retail passage, cafes, restaurants and attractive public space around the facility. Will the investors of office projects bet on the investments that include multiple functions?
High level of supply continuing on the office market makes investors more willing to reach for custom solutions and introduce changes in the structure of the projects. On both the Warsaw market and in the regional cities, there are more and more multifunctional projects, which paradoxically are still treated as a niche. It seems, however, that this type of facilities which are more attractive for tenants than the strictly office projects, in the long run have a chance to become a significant part of the commercial real estate segment.
In the referred projects, the hotels are often designed along with the office buildings, and the entire complex is also enriched by conference, recreation as well as retail and service zone. The buildings are often accompanied by well-arranged public spaces surrounding them. Such investments instantly have a larger audience, because they provide a set of basic services on the premises. The hotels emerging in such buildings provide a broader service in the complex and attract customers to the retail zone also outside working hours of the offices.
The more functions the project offers, the easier for tenants
Bartłomiej Zagrodnik, CEO of Walter Herz consulting company, admits that the way of functioning of the companies, as well as the requirements of the tenants when it comes to the leased office space are closely related with the expectations of their employees. - The office space, as well as the entire complex, has to provide a maximum comfort in everyday functioning in the workplace - notes Zagrodnik. - The investments, which in addition to the standard catering service as well as retail and service points, offer direct access to all kinds of institutions, such as medical services, a fitness club, restaurants, cafes, pubs, kindergarten, as well as hotel located on the premises, which is a great convenience for business travelers, attract special attention of the companies - says Bartłomiej Zagrodnik.
Walter Herz experts, who are currently negotiating the implementation of 8 hotel buildings with the total area of over 50 sq m, pointed out that the construction will require a large involvement and appropriate approach at the stage of planning and designing the building from the developer. - It is about the specifics of construction of a hotel. It is about separating the elevators and entrances to the building and breaking down operating costs through proper design and installation of customized water and sewage system, which is much more elaborate compared to the buildings that fulfill the classic office function. All of these divisions are designed to optimize operating costs attributed to each function, and finding the most rational way of sharing them between the tenants. A good arrangement of the dining area, designed according to the number of hotel stars, or the use of additional attributes of the building, such as the placement of the terraces in the case of high-rises and other attractions in the building are also very important. - say Walter Herz experts.
The most dynamic market to test mixed-use projects is Warsaw, but also other cities. Investments offering different functions are emerging in Wrocław, Łodź, Gdynia, Lublin, Katowice, Poznań, Rzeszów and Szczecin.
Łódź
Arche company is planning a multifunctional building in Łódź at the intersection of al. Włókniarzy and al. Mickiewicza Streets. The complex will combine a hotel, office and service function. In a five-storey building there will be a hotel with 300 rooms and several thousand square meters of office space and conference rooms.
Piotrkowska 155 office and hotel complex in Łódź will include three buildings with a nine-storey office tower measuring 76 meters, a seven-storey hotel and a five-storey office building. After the opening, which is scheduled for the first quarter of 2018, the facility will provide more than 25 thousand sq m of space, including 21 thousand sq m of A + class office space and 4 thousand sq m of retail space. Hampton by Hilton hotel with 149 rooms will be connected to higher office building with a common ground floor and the first floor, where the area of 2 thousand sq m will include shops, cafes, restaurants, a fitness center and a medical clinic. The investor, Bacoli Properties company plans to start the construction work in November. The company is currently continuing to prepare the site for the construction.
In the third quarter of 2016, Warimpex Polska company intends to start the construction of the office building in Łódź. The facility, which will consist of two buildings on the corner of Zachodnia and Ogrodowa Streets near the andel's hotel, which is also the company's project. The façade of the office building will correspond with the design of the hotel. The higher building will have a façade made of the red brick, and the five-storey one will have a glass one, which will reflect Pałac Poznańskich building. The authors of the design of the office and hotel declare that the elevation of the new building will refer to the history of Łódź. The office building will include an internal passage, which will be the link between Manufaktura, andel's and pl. Wolności square. Such solution is to activate the surrounding space and recall the tradition of the city associated with the passages inside the courtyards. The ground floor of the building, with the area of 3.9 thousand sq m, will include a retail and service points, on the upper floors there will be offices, on the ground floor there will be restaurants and bars, and below there will be two levels of parking.
Wrocław
The apartments, a hotel and the offices were designed in the multifunctional complex OVO Wrocław, which was built by Wrocław's Promenada Staromiejska promenade and will soon be open. The operator of the five-star hotel, which will include 189 luxurious rooms, is DoubleTree by Hilton. The building will also include 7 conference rooms, which together with a banquet hall can host up to 500 people. In addition, it will have a sports club, a fitness center with a swimming pool and SPA, restaurants, a cafe and a casino. It is worth noticing the original shape of the building, which resembles a drop of water with a façade without the edges and corners.
Two years ago in Wrocław by Plac Konstytucji 3 Maja square, Wisher Enterprise company built Silver Tower Center, which combines different functions. It consists of two complementary segments with a higher 14-storey part, where on most floors there are offices and a 6-storey lower part with a hotel and conference center as well as retail and service space. The property located close to Wrocław railway and bus stations is distinguished by the shape, which invigorates the eastern end of Pilsudskiego Street. The property has an elegant glass façade, which has been divided into vertical, clear profiles.
Warsaw
The flagship Warsaw mixed-use project is Koneser Praga Center located on the 5-hectare plot by Ząbkowska Street, in the heart of the old Praga district. The revitalization of Warsaw Vodka Factory included the adaptation of the historic buildings and the construction of the new ones. Koneser Praga Center is the first real estate development project in Warsaw, which involves a combination of so many functions. In addition to over 300 apartments built by BBI Development company, the building will include 25.5 thousand sq m of A and B + class offices and 21 thousand sq m of retail space, including a conference center, a hotel and the world's first Polish Vodka Museum. Commissioning of the whole building is planned for 2017.
The reconstruction of Hotel Europejski has been continuing in Warsaw for the last three years. After the renovation is over, the building is to join the Raffles chain and become the most luxurious hotel in Poland. However, it will not only be a hotel, but also a high class multifunctional facility. The prestigious building by Krakowskie Przedmieście Street will include over 100 luxurious rooms and suites, retail and service area, with among others, boutiques of global brands, as well as A class office space. The finishing works in the office and service area will last until the end of 2016. The launching of the hotel is planned for mid 2017.
The office building with the additional hotel function is to emerge in the center of the city, between the streets of Pańska, Śliska and Emilii Plater, where Emilia pavilion is still standing. The investor already has zoning for this project and is working on the architectural design of the facility.
Also in the Warsaw district of Mokotów, Eiffage Immobilier Polska and Avestus Real Estate companies are planning to build CUBE office building, with approx. 21 thousand sq m of space. A hotel with approx. 6 thousand sq m area will be adjacent to the office building.
The preparatory work for the construction of a spectacular investment in Modlin near Warsaw is also beginning. Warszawa Modlin Smart City will be built by 2020 in the area of the historic Modlin Fortress, a system of fortifications with the area 58 hectares, located at the confluence of the Vistula and Narew rivers. Currently, a feasibility study for hotel properties, which are to be built as part of this investment are under preparation. Modlin Fortress was bought from the Military Property Agency by Grupa Konkret, which has a plan to turn the area into a city of smart solutions. The company announced the construction of a spectacular complex with multiple functions. The project includes the construction of the largest in this part of Europe convention center, two hotels, a residential estate and office and retail space. The investment's location by Modlin airport and the proximity of nature reserves and the Kampinos National Park are an advantage.
Gdynia
A modern, multifunctional complex Gdynia Waterfront is being built in Gdynia by Skwer Kościuszki square. After the completion, the project will provide 90 thousand sq m of space in residential, commercial, retail and cultural facilities, as well as office space and a hotel with the conference center. The investor - Vastint company, which belongs to the Inter IKEA Group, took care of the layout of the public space with walkways and squares nearby the buildings. In the first stage of the project at the beginning of 2015, two buildings with office and hotel functions with the leasable area of 20 thousand sq m were commissioned. The office building has been designed entirely for headquarters of PKO BP bank, a four-star hotel operates under the brand name Marriott Courtyard. The subsequent stages of the project are currently in the planning phase and are to be implemented in the upcoming years.
Szczecin
According to the announcement of the investor, the BCG Szczecin company, the construction of the hotel building and an office building is about to start by Gdańska Street in Szczecin. Office, retail and hotel investment - Szczecin Odra Park will be the largest mixed-use complex in the city, and will offer a total of over 42 thousand sq m of space. Apart from the high-class office space, it will include a three-star hotel with 144 rooms and more than 4 thousand sq m of retail and service area.
Katowice
The center of Katowice has recently been going through a real metamorphosis. One of the most significant investments is office and hotel complex emerging by Wojewódzka Street. The investor of Centrum Wojewódzka 10 is Wojewódzka Office company, which belongs to Grupa Kapitałowa KG Group company from Cracow. The facility will offer office space situated on the ground floor and another four floors, and will be ready later this year. Apart from that, a three star hotel building with 124 rooms is also under construction. Built on the former parking lot behind the movie theater Rialto, Q Hotel is expected to open in the spring of 2017.
Lublin
The owner of Lublin Galeria Olimp mall is also planning to build a mixed-use investment. An office building and a hotel are to be built in close proximity to the modernized mall. Next year, Transhurt company plans to demolish the existing headquarters, an office building by al. Spółdzielczości Pracy Street and build a three-star hotel with 50 rooms and a new office building. The entire complex will be ready by 2019.
Poznań
The old railway station in Poznań is to be reconstructed by 2019. The development of Poznań Główny railway station is the last stage of the project started at the station in 2011. The project involves the construction of an office complex and a hotel with a complementary retail and service function. According to the representatives of Xcity Investment company, on the lower level of the old station, the passenger functions will be restored , together with the historic façade of the station building. Poznań Główny III project is expected to provide 46 thousand sq m of commercial GLA and its estimated value is 96 million euro. The investment is to be carried out by a Hungarian developer - TriGranit company, which has built the new Poznań Główny railway station and Poznań City Center shopping center.
One of the five 12-storey Alpha office towers is also to change its function. The buildings which are symbolic for Poznań and used to shine in the People's Republic of Poland (PRL) era, now require a thorough modernization. The building located by Ratajczaka Street will be the one to undergo it. The office building was purchased by Altus Hotel Mięczkowski company, which intends to begin its reconstruction in September. After one year the company will open a three-star hotel with 110 rooms under its own brand with conference rooms and a restaurant.
